Answer:
(x - 2)^2 + (y + 5)^2 = 5
Step-by-step explanation:
If the center is at (h, k) : (2, -5), then the general form of the equation of this circle is
(x - 2)^2 + (y + 5)^2 = r^2, and we must find r^2.
We know that (3, -3) is a point on the circle. Substitute 3 for x and -3 for y in the above equation to find r^2:
(3 - 2)^2 + (-3 + 5)^2 = r^2, or
1^2 + 2^2 = r^2
Then r^2 = 5, and the desired equation is
(x - 2)^2 + (y + 5)^2 = 5 or (√5)^2

No, they forgot to switch variable labels after solving for the independent variable...
y=-8x+4
y-4=-8x
(y-4)/-8=x
Now that you have solved for the independent variable x, you switch the variable labels...
y=(x-4)/-8
f^-1(x)=(x-4)/-8 which should really be rewritten as:
f^-1(x)=(4-x)/8 :P
